In these darkly comic supernatural stories, horror and wonder bleed into everyday life.
A forest witch haunts a golf course, while Annie defends her vegetable patch from dark forces. A would-be detective falls for a femme fatale in a seaside town, and a lonely Victorian girl makes a startling new friend.
In twenty bittersweet, uncanny stories, Sarah Jackson explores love and loneliness, trauma and transformation, solidarity and greed.
Sarah Jackson (she/they) writes speculative fiction and poetry which has appeared in Strange Horizons, Tales From Between, Wyldblood Magazine, and elsewhere. She is editor of Inner Worlds, a digital zine of speculative stories about our inner lives.
